I am Catherine from 2E4.

On this motion, I disagree that online debating is more interesting than classroom debating. Firstly, in classroom debating, the speaker get to say their points and explanantion with expression and also can add more drama to the speech.Usually, when the speaker speaks with such emotion on their stand, people will tend to be more interested. However in online debating, it is just words on the computer which portrays no emotion,so in a way, it is quite boring.

Secondly, in classroom debates, the other side will rebutt and say their main points almost immediately.Therefore, classroom debates will be faster than online debates. However, in online debating, we might have to wait to get a reply from the other team. This process can be quite slow and the debate will be never-ending.

Thirdly, online debate does not spark much interest in getting the other team to rebutt. However, in classroom debate, you get to see the person faace to face and will feel a sudden urge to argue with their point.

Fourthly, classroom debates can also train our "brain-power" as we are supposed to think our rebuttals on the spot. However, on online debating, we can take some time to think about our rebuttal so it is actually not as fun as classroom debating.
